Step-by-step explanation:
Let x represent the number of sales each man had.
For Salesman A, he earns $65 per sale; this is 65x.
For Salesman B, he earns $40 per sale; this is 40x. We also add to this his weekly salary of $300; this gives us 40x+300.
Since their pay was equal, set the two expressions equal:
65x = 40x+300
Subtract 40x from each side:
65x-40x = 40x+300-40x
25x = 300
Divide both sides by 25:
25x/25 = 300/25
x = 12
